Transaction 36331d0af1ae6c79fe0221c98c60c5a11fc1b4aed04117631d7d23d479a62016

1 Input
1 Outputs
  • 36331d0af1ae6c79fe0221c98c60c5a11fc1b4aed04117631d7d23d479a62016:0
  • value  20212
    address  3CCPLHBDyZKSoRQLb4G72iqEGLvaeAwEdi